What drives a fast rollout in AI visibility platforms?

Fast rollout is driven by lightweight integrations, clear governance, and predictable setup that minimize friction.

In practice, rollout cadences vary: most platforms reach 2–4 weeks, while some enterprise deployments extend to 6–8 weeks due to security checks, data-connectivity maturity, and cross‑team coordination. Enterprise platforms differ in architecture and governance, which shapes adoption speed; robust pre-built connectors and standardized data schemas help teams move quickly. How do security and compliance influence rollout speed?

Security and compliance controls can accelerate or constrain rollout depending on how governance is embedded in the platform.

SOC 2 Type II, HIPAA readiness, and other controls shape deployment velocity by determining how quickly vendors can demonstrate controls and enable cross-border use. Platforms with pre-certified artifacts, standardized audit reports, and integrated identity management typically shorten cycles; bespoke or ad hoc audits can slow progress.
